United Kingdom Private Healthcare Market US$ 18.56 billion by 2033, key Players:- Bupa Cromwell Hospital, Spire Healthcare Group, Circle Health Group.
The UK private healthcare market size reached US$ 13.75 billion in 2024 is expected to reach US$ 18.56 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 3.4% during the forecast period 2025-2033. The shift toward minimally invasive procedures, same-day surgery, and high-end diagnostics is accelerating the growth of the UK private healthcare market. Key Industry Development-
✅ November 2025: Indian healthcare provider Narayana Hrudayalaya fully acquired UK-based Practice Plus Group Hospitals Limited for approximately £183 million, marking a significant entry into the UK market.
✅ August 2025: Bupa completed its acquisition of in Kingston upon Thames, a strategic move to integrate primary and secondary care services and expand its hospital network.
✅ August 2025: The private healthcare market experienced a slight decline in total reported admissions for Q1 2025 (down 1% compared to Q1 2024), which included a 4% fall in self-pay admissions.
✅ June 2025: The UK government announced a £29 billion real-terms funding increase for the NHS in 2025-26, which is expected to slightly ease pressures on the public system and influence the private sector dynamic.
✅ April 2025: Optima Health, an AIM-listed company, acquired Cognate Health, expanding its presence in the Republic of Ireland and contributing to the strong M&A activity in the health and social care sectors.
✅ March 2025: Kube Medical acquired to expand its specialist infant feeding support services to new locations, reflecting consolidation in niche service areas.
✅ January 2025: The government confirmed the "New Hospitals Programme" would proceed with a £15 billion investment, with two new facilities opening (and Dyson Cancer Centre), aiming to ease capacity issues in the long term.
Market Dynamics
→ Drivers: Rising self-pay and private medical insurance uptake is significantly driving the UK private healthcare market growth
Over the past five years, the UK private healthcare market has seen a significant increase in self-pay procedures and employer-funded private medical insurance (PMI), boosting revenue for hospital operators. Spire Healthcare reported that self-pay revenue reached one-third of its total UK income in 2023, while large employers expanded PMI benefits to support staff retention and reduce sickness absence. This has fueled growth at insurers like Bupa, AXA Health, and Vitality Health, and pushed more insured patients into private hospital networks. This has led to a larger flow of privately funded patients and insured referrals, underpinning capital investment in new facilities.
→ For instance, UK's Private Healthcare Information Network (PHIN) reported 238,000 more private hospital admissions in January to March 2024 compared to any previous quarter. The majority of these admissions were funded using private medical insurance (PMI), with the largest increases in the 20-29 and 30-39 age groups by 13%.
→ Restraints: High treatment costs & affordability issues are hampering the growth of the UK private healthcare market
Private healthcare costs remain a significant barrier to access, especially for self-pay patients and small-to-medium enterprises offering PMI. Complex procedures like joint replacements and advanced cancer therapies can cost thousands of pounds, limiting access to higher-income segments. Even with insurance coverage, high excesses or co-payments reduce affordability, constraining volume growth. This challenge affects private hospitals' ability to expand beyond premium and insured populations, driving competition around price transparency, bundled-care packages, and elective day-case procedures to attract cost-conscious patients.

Market Segmenatation-
The UK private healthcare market is segmented based on service type, application, and end user.
→ Service Type: The private acute care hospitals from service type segment to dominate the UK private healthcare market with a 38.1% share in 2024
The private acute care hospital segment is gaining popularity due to increased demand for elective surgeries, specialist care, and NHS outsourcing. Long waiting times for orthopaedic, cardiology, and ophthalmology interventions have led to patients choosing private hospitals like Spire Healthcare, Ramsay Health Care UK, and Bupa Cromwell. Growth in employer-sponsored private medical insurance and self-pay packages has provided a steady revenue stream for hospitals, enabling investment in advanced surgical theatres, robotic-assisted surgery, and diagnostic imaging.
Moreover, private acute care hospitals are at the forefront of adopting cutting-edge medical technologies. Investments in robotic-assisted surgeries, advanced imaging systems, and state-of-the-art surgical theatres have enhanced the quality and efficiency of care. For instance, Spire Healthcare has reported a 12.7% increase in revenue, partly attributed to its investment in technology and expansion of services, including orthopaedic surgeries and cancer treatments.
→ Application: The general surgery segment is estimated to have a 40.1% of the UK private healthcare market share in 2024
The UK private healthcare market is experiencing growth in the general surgery segment due to rising demand for elective procedures, technological advancements, and the flexibility of private care providers. Patients are choosing private hospitals like Spire Healthcare, Ramsay Health Care UK, and Bupa Cromwell for procedures like hernia repairs and minor abdominal surgeries to avoid long NHS waiting times. The adoption of minimally invasive and laparoscopic techniques makes private general surgery more attractive to self-pay and insured patients. NHS outsourcing contracts and corporate health schemes support this growth. Rising awareness of preventive care and patient-centric services also drives demand in this segment.
For instance, in August 2025, Bupa has completed the acquisition of New Victoria Hospital, an independent private facility located in Kingston upon Thames. This marks Bupa's first hospital acquisition in the UK since 2008 and allows for more integrated patient pathways, linking primary care services directly with secondary care. The hospital features 33 beds and offers specialised care in orthopaedics, gynaecology, general surgery, and gastroenterology. Its state-of-the-art infrastructure includes a 128-slice CT scanner, a fluoroscopy suite, and a 1.5‐tonne MRI system.
UK Private Healthcare Market Regional Insights (2025)
→ London & South East: Dominant region with 47.5% market share . High concentration of private hospitals, affluent populations, and premium facilities drive demand.
→ Southwest England: Growing via 5 new NHS-partnered Community Diagnostic Centres (Bristol, Redruth, Yeovil, Torbay, Weston-super-Mare), expanding private access.
→ Northern England & Wales: Underserved (17.5% share) due to fewer facilities; rural access challenges persist despite NHS overflow partnerships.

Competitive Landscape
→ Top companies in the UK private healthcare market include Bupa Cromwell Hospital, Althea Group, The London Clinic, GenesisCare, Great Ormond Street Hospital (GOSH), Ramsay Health Care UK, Aspen Healthcare (Tenet Healthcare), Spire Healthcare Group plc, the Bournemouth Private Clinic Limited, Circle Health Group (PureHealth) and among others.
Bupa Cromwell Hospital:- Bupa Cromwell Hospital is a leading UK private acute care facility, offering specialist services in cardiology, orthopaedics, oncology, and paediatrics. It bridges the gap between NHS capacity and patient demand, providing faster access to complex procedures for both self-pay and insured patients. With advanced diagnostic and treatment infrastructure like MRI, CT, and state-of-the-art surgical theatres, it supports high-quality, consultant-led care. Bupa Cromwell contributes significantly to the growth and development of the UK's private healthcare sector.
Market Drivers:-
→ Rising self-pay and private medical insurance (PMI) uptake - Increasing numbers of people are paying out-of-pocket or using employer-sponsored PMI to access private care. This shift has significantly boosted revenues for private hospitals.
→ Pressure on public system (NHS) - long waiting times & capacity constraints - Growing NHS waitlists and delays in elective or specialist procedures push patients toward private providers for faster treatment.
→ Demographic shifts - aging population & chronic illness prevalence - With more elderly people and rising chronic disease burden (e.g. cardiovascular disease, arthritis), demand increases for timely specialist care, diagnostics, and elective procedures.
